Four-Gear Fidget
This is a print-in-place model that I printed on my Bambu P1S. I have not tested this yet on my Ender 3 S1 yet, so results may vary!
It's a pretty simple print. Once it's done, just wiggle the gears up and down to break free from any overhangs that slightly stuck to the gears. Once you've done that, it should be pretty easy to start spinning!
Print Details:
- Pla
- 15% infill
- No supports
- No rafts
